EVM7 Indoor Air Quality Monitor

New, easy to use environmental monitor combines several instruments into one.

  • Simultaneously measures and logs particulates (mass concentration), volatile organic compounds (VOCs), toxic gas, carbon dioxide (CO2), relative humidity, temperature and air velocity (with optional accessory).
  • Provides a cost-effective solution and reduces the need for multiple instruments.

Real-Time Direct Reading Particulate Monitor

  • Features patent-pending dial-in impactor system for quick particulate selection.
  • Built-in sampling pump assists in the collection of particulates while the light scattering photometer mass concentration engine provides real-time measurement.
  • Insert a standard 37 mm cassette for gravimetric sampling and laboratory analysis. Comprehensive PID and Smart Sensor Measurement
  • High-performance Photoionization Detector (PID) measures volatile organic compounds(VOCs).
  • Smart sensors offer automatic recognition at power-on and store sensor specific information.
  • Download data into QuestSuite®Professional II for detailed analysis.

EVM-3 Environmental Monitor

Real-Time Direct Reading Particulate Monitor.

The EVM-3 provides real-time direct reading of particulate concentrations, along with temperature and relative humidity measurements. The patent-pending dial-in impactors allow for quick selection of particulate settings PM2.5, PM4, PM10 or TSP (within the instrument's measurement range) without disassembly.

A built-in air sampling pump assists in the collection of particulates while the laser photometer provides real-time measurement. A standard 25 or 37 mm gravimetric cassette can be utilized for sampling and laboratory analysis, and help provide correlation for real-time direct reading measurements.

EVM-4 Environmental Monitor

Comprehensive Indoor Air Quality Analysis.

The EVM-4 is designed for comprehensive indoor air quality analysis with its ability to simultaneously monitor and log one toxic gas, carbon dioxide, relative humidity and temperature.

The instrument's compact size and displayed overview of parameters make indoor air quality assessment easy.

This versatile monitor features a tripod mount and security code protection for unattended stationary studies.

Additionally, the EVM-4 offers calculation of room air exchange rates with carbon dioxide trending algorithms for in-depth air quality evaluation (with QuestSuite? Professional II software).

QT Heat Stress Monitors

The datalogging QUESTemp° 36 is the premier monitor within the QUESTemp° Series of Thermal Environment Monitors.

The QUESTemp° 36 further simplifies heat stress management efforts by providing users with realtime guidance on stay times and work/rest regimens. Guidance is based on screening criteria for heat stress as defined in the ACGIH TLV Handbook,U.S. Navy PHEL Charts and EPRI Action Limits.

The QUESTemp° 36 eliminates the need to carry paper charts, pocket guides and look-up tables into the field.

An optional detachable probe for measuring air velocity extends the applications for the QUESTemp° 36 beyond traditional heat stress measurements. The QUESTemp° 36 can be used as an indoor thermal comfort monitor using the air velocity probe, temperature and RH sensor readings simultaneously.

Other applications include verification of air flow in fume hoods or rooms normally requiring a minimum amount of air flow to be safe for occupancy.

QUESTemp III Personal Thermal Comfort Monitor

The QUESTemp° II is a datalogging Personal Heat Stress Monitor. Based on extensive research funded by the Electric Power Research institute and performed by Westinghouse Electric and Pennsylvania State University, it monitors both body temperature and heart rate to calculate individual body strain in response to heat stress.

It uses a two-stage audio/visual alarm. The first stage "Warning Alert" indicates that conditions are approaching a level where there is a limited amount of time to work. The second stage "Action Alert" indicates that the worker should stop work immediately and take necessary actions.

The watertight lightweight monitor assembly can be slipped into a shirt pocket or clipped to a belt while the elastic sensor belt assembly is worn comfortably around the chest. It is programmable for the appropriate age group and clothing type of the individual being monitored.

Heart rate, temperature, and heat strain alert status are recorded once every minute and stamped with the date and time to correlate events and pinpoint problems.

Output recorded data directly to a serial printer or download to QuestSuite Professional software, "The System Solution" for storage, retrieval, analysis, reporting, and charting of all your heat stress monitoring data.
